Keirei lamp by Fabio Schiavetto and Riccardo Furlanetto


The Keirei lamp, designed by Fabio Schiavetto and Riccardo Furlanetto for the Italian company Torremato by Il Fanale Group, is an unconventional lighting piece.


Keirei, which means 'a bow' in Japanese, has been designed to pay homage to the environment. A tribute to the oriental ritual that results in a lamp, Keirei features the look of a tube bowed downwards with a strong expressive power.

Made of glass and cast iron, the Keirei lamp is expressive of all its evocative potential with material charm and clean design elements. Keirei can fit into all kinds of environment, both indoor as well as outdoor.

Available in two finishes like natural antique and grey, the Keirei lamp is unalterable and resistant to any weather conditions. It measures base Ø cm 20, height cm 41 and uses E27 e POWER LED light for illumination.
